The trip from Merrillville to Birmingham is a 950 km journey. Driving via I-65 South is the most popular method, taking about 10 hours through Indianapolis, Louisville, and Nashville. Alternatively, you can fly from Chicago O'Hare to Birmingham-Shuttlesworth International Airport, with a flight time of 2 hours. This route takes you from the industrial Midwest into the heart of the American South.
Total Distance: Driving distance 950 km, straight-line air distance 800 km.
